I was hoping they'd have a confirmed answer by now as to what caused the sonic boom here on May 28. A jet? A meteor? But there is no consensus. NASA says no meteor. A couple of people who track meteors have indications it was a meteor.
I felt it as a big ::WHOOMP:: - similar to the booms earlier this year when Fort Jackson exploded old ordinance. The cams rarely pick up earth movement but this time even one of the cams shook a little, along with picking up the sound.
